2.3.3. RS-232 control port

Devices can be remote controlled through industry standard 9 pin D-SUB female connector
located on the rear panel of the unit. Please use a standard RS-232 Male to Female cable
(straight through).
RS-232 port settings on the PC:
9600 Baud, 8 data bit, 1 stop bit, no parity

2.3.4. Alarm outputs (receiver)

TTL outputs can be used to give a signal to any third party device. Separate signals indicate
the detected laser and the presence of the received DVI signal.

Indicates when a valid DVI clock signal is extracted from the fiber
optical signal. Logic 1 (+5V) means that a DVI signal is detected.
Logic 0 (GND) means that a valid DVI signal cannot be extracted
from the optical signal.
Indicates when a laser beam is detected at the Neutrik connector.
Logic 1 (+5V) means that a laser beam with the appropriate
wavelength is detected. Logic 0 (GND) means that either there is
no laser signal or its level is too low to be recognized.
Ground reference signal for alarm outputs. Connected to chassis
ground.
